Shipping scams
Is EBay doing anything to address the rise in fraudulent sellers ripping off buyers by providing fake tracking information. How are these scam artists able to enter fake tracking information into the buyers order??

Mentor2 years agoThe scammers are using real tracking numbers of items shipped to another location in the same zip code, at least in some cases.

You can avoid many issues by choosing to only do business with experienced sellers that have a proven track record of delivering similar items as seen by examining the seller's feedback page, and by avoiding inexperienced sellers, sellers with patterns of negative feedback indicating serious problems, drop shippers, or sellers with large gaps in the selling history or recent drastic changes of seller behavior.
